General Information
Title: Regina Caeli Laetare a 6
Composer: Cristóbal de Morales
Number of voices: 6vv Voicing: SSAATB
Genre: Sacred, Motet
Language: Latin
Instruments: a cappella

Original text and translations
Latin text
Regina cæli lætare,
alleluia.
Quia quem meruisti portare
alleluia.
Resurrexit sicut dixit
alleluia.
Ora pro nobis Deum
alleluia.
